Taco Board
Shake up your Taco Tuesday with a colorful whole food plant-based spread that lets everyone be their own chef!
Load up a big board with seasoned black beans, salsa, greens or shredded purple cabbage, a quick guacamole, bell peppers, and fresh cilantro - then add your favorite tortillas and let everyone build their own masterpiece.
The best part? Everything can be prepped earlier in the day, making dinner a breeze, and any leftover fillings become tomorrow's burrito bowl or tasty salad topper.
What you need:
2 cans of black beans drained and rinsed
1 package of taco seasoning, we used a package from Trader Joe’s
2-3 tomatoes washed and chopped
1 bell pepper washed and sliced
Your favorite salsa
Greens of choice
Your favorite taco shells
3 avocados for guacamole.
Instructions:Place black beans in skillet on low and add seasoning and water (follow package instructions)
Mash 3 avocados on plate, add 1/4 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on cumin, black pepper to taste. Mix, taste, adjust seasonings.
You can also add 1/8-1/4 cup of chopped cilantro if you’d like.
Set all ingredients out on your favorite board, in different bowls place: hot beans, salsa, guacamole.
